629 WWUS82 KJAX 141915 SPSJAX Special Weather Statement National Weather Service Jacksonville FL 315 PM EDT Sun Jul 14 2024 FLZ140-240-141945- Central Marion FL-Eastern Marion FL- 315 PM EDT Sun Jul 14 2024 ...A STRONG THUNDERSTORM WILL IMPACT NORTHEASTERN MARION COUNTY THROUGH 345 PM EDT... At 315 PM EDT, Doppler radar was tracking a strong thunderstorm near Lynne, moving northwest at 15 mph. HAZARD...Wind gusts around 40 mph and excessive cloud-to-ground lightning. SOURCE...Radar indicated. IMPACT...Gusty winds could knock down tree limbs and blow around unsecured objects. Excessive cloud-to-ground lightning is occurring. Locations impacted include... Fort McCoy, Lynne, and Burbank. P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S... If outdoors, consider seeking shelter inside a building. && LAT...LON 2917 8184 2923 8210 2942 8207 2936 8180 TIME...MOT...LOC 1915Z 156DEG 11KT 2925 8194 MAX HAIL SIZE...0.00 IN MAX WIND GUST...40 MPH $$ CHANEY
